(317) 255-5616
525 Buckingham Dr
Indianapolis, IN 46208
Categories
Web Site Design & Services
Internet Products & Services
Computer System Designers & Consultants
Computer Software & Services
Graphic Designers
Computer & Equipment Dealers
Social Links
Site: http://www.webpagebuilders.com
Google Maps
Waze